
Many people think that "stewardship" is all about giving money to the church. It is often recognized as just a church word, but stewardship is so much more than that. We are here to help you understand the broad meaning of Stewardship. This concept permeates every aspect of your life. To steward is to take care of the things that have been entrusted to you.
